Projects

Asia Pacific forestry skills and capacity building program
The Asia Pacific forestry skills and capacity building program is a four year program that will assist countries in the Asia Pacific region to increase their forest management expertise and improve the carbon sequestration performance of their forests and is funded by the Department of Agriculture, Fisheries and Forestry. » more
Skills Enhancement and Training (SET)
The Skills Enhancement and Training project is a program whose aim is to facilitate an increase in the skill levels of workers in industry to address changed forest management, harvesting procedures and production processes. » more
Moving women in forestry
ForestWorks has secured funding under the National Skills Shortages Strategy on behalf of the Department of Education, Employment and Workplace Relations (DEEWR) for the Women in Forestry Project. The purpose of the project is to look for strategies that expand the roles of women and increase their participation rates in our industry. » more
